72 Commits (d2c2c07ad24e6336fcdf83c6e535453e36cfd3c0)

Author SHA1 Message Date
Vadim Pisarevsky 90e191211e increased "inf" constant in the true distance transform algorithm to handle high-resolution images 14 years ago
Vadim Pisarevsky 4ad938afcc fixed incorrect sign of the result of the convolution with normalized asymmetric kernels (ticket #779) 14 years ago
Vadim Pisarevsky e90f197beb merged fix for x64 MSVC compile errors in highgui into trunk 14 years ago
Vladimir Dudnik b6f53fc465 cosmetic changes, removed trailing spaces 14 years ago
Vadim Pisarevsky 5633cf0379 one more fix in the recently rewritten copyMakeBorder 14 years ago
Vadim Pisarevsky 51d039945a fixed cv::CHAIN_APPROX_* definitions (ticket #755) 14 years ago
Vadim Pisarevsky 76c8a7d96b rewrote copyMakeBorder (to support other border types and fix some bugs) 14 years ago
Vadim Pisarevsky fcdce4edcb fixed border processing bayer2rgb & bayer2gray; made the test "color-bayer" pass; renamed CV_Bayer*2Gray -> CV_Bayer*2GRAY for consistency 14 years ago
Vadim Pisarevsky da293ee3d9 SSE2 optimization for Bayer->RGB; added Bayer->Gray with SSE2 optimization; corrected some bugs noted in the yahoogroups forum 14 years ago
Vadim Pisarevsky 6a15ff8d13 added cvSave(contours) to the contours demo; added rational model demonstration to stereo_calib; fixed formatting in imgproc/types_c.h 14 years ago
Vadim Pisarevsky 8af2d0acb4 fixed recent failures in shape-convhull & shape-minarearect 14 years ago
Vadim Pisarevsky 70d2c57e35 moved estimateAffine3D declaration from imgproc to calib3d, where it is really implemented (ticket #705) 14 years ago
Vadim Pisarevsky a937d9d43c unified the coordinate interpretation in RotatedRect (ticket #425) 14 years ago
Vadim Pisarevsky cbe132cabe several small fixes; added overloaded variant of cv::drawChessboardCorners 14 years ago
Vadim Pisarevsky 54ef4c08c2 moved some old stuff to the legacy module; merge "compat_c.h" headers and moved to the legacy as well. moved implementation of many non-critical/obsolete inline functions and methods to .cpp to improve Opencv build time 14 years ago
Vadim Pisarevsky 59e2afe4d2 fixed the ordering of parameters in PyArg_ParseTupleAndKeywords, added correct Ptr<CvDTreeSplit>::delete_obj() (ticket #406) 14 years ago
Vadim Pisarevsky 1286c1db45 fixed multiple warnings from VS2010. 14 years ago
Vadim Pisarevsky d366c0b2fa fixed canny test; fixed mhi-global test & implementation (hopefully, for the last time); added sse 4.1 & 4.2 support (not working in Xcode for some reason); moved splineInterpolation to color.cpp; fixed a few bugs in documentation 14 years ago
Vadim Pisarevsky f5e5b677c9 added hconcat & vconcat functions for joining matrices; moved some inline functions out of the headers; fixed several bugs in documentation; removed MatND from docs 14 years ago
Ethan Rublee 89c4bc54d9 fix little warning - opencv2/imgproc/types_c.h:235: warning: comma at end of enumerator list 14 years ago
Vadim Pisarevsky cf0d9da643 added 64f support in cv::resize 14 years ago
Vadim Pisarevsky e18427b139 another fix on the ticket #518 - ignore all the circles with radius outside of the specified range 14 years ago
Vadim Pisarevsky ce41f74ab4 decreased the lower canny threshold in HoughCircles, helps to detect some circles in low-contrast images (ticket #518) 14 years ago
Vadim Pisarevsky 9785cc1427 removed memset in cv::pyrMeanShiftFiltering (ticket #664) 14 years ago
Vadim Pisarevsky de4f1aeb06 fixed some GCC 4.4 warnings 14 years ago
Vadim Pisarevsky 96ad3b57b8 LANCZOS4 interpolation constant added to C interface 14 years ago
Vadim Pisarevsky 6cd01dc6ca mapstep type was also changed to ptrdiff_t (ticket #157) 14 years ago
Vadim Pisarevsky 1fce36a164 try to make a more elegant workaround for the incorrectly generated code in Canny (ticket #157) 14 years ago
Vadim Pisarevsky 5791e89e4d fixed buffer allocation for constant-value borders in the filter engine (ticket #524) 14 years ago
Vadim Pisarevsky bffb5f8b58 fixed initialization of the border interpolation table in the filter engine (ticket #161) 14 years ago
Vadim Pisarevsky 957cff2493 rewrote matchTemplate in C++; added border awareness to crossCorr (ticket #557) 14 years ago
Vadim Pisarevsky 9e7b8d5f67 rewrote matchTemplate in C++; added border awareness to crossCorr (ticket #557) 14 years ago
Vadim Pisarevsky 8217b34f60 fixed transparent border handling one more time (tickets #572 & #575) 14 years ago
Maria Dimashova 762cf182ef modified grabCut: noise is added only if covariance determinant = 0 14 years ago
Vadim Pisarevsky 79ca6d8995 fixed sparse histogram update (ticket #526) 14 years ago
Vadim Pisarevsky e15a2ea95a fixed remap with transparent border (ticket #582) 14 years ago
Vadim Pisarevsky e6b2efeb11 further improved accuracy of Delaunay triangulation (ticket #433) 14 years ago
Maria Dimashova f76d393910 fixed grabCut: moved to double precision and added the noise to avoid zero determinant of covariance matrix 14 years ago
Vadim Pisarevsky 7f3ae3a011 fixed crash in color-luv when OpenCV is built using GCC 4.1 14 years ago
Vadim Pisarevsky 378af78e6a made calcBackproject slightly more robust. 14 years ago
Vadim Pisarevsky 5a53d82e30 fixed most of the failures in opencv_test 14 years ago
Vadim Pisarevsky b5f366fb70 fixed possible overflow in getThreshVal_Otsu_8u (ticket #602) 14 years ago
Vadim Pisarevsky 5b6a755719 almost finished Python wrappers 14 years ago
Vadim Pisarevsky 893fb90b87 extended Python bindings; not merged into cv.cpp yet; and many of the helper functions, like pyopencv_to_*, pyopencv_from_* etc. are still missing 14 years ago
Vadim Pisarevsky 83f6085773 added more helper macros to the function declarations, to assist the Python wrapper generator. Fixed memleak in Mat::operator()(Range,Range) and the related functions (Mat::row, Mat::col etc.) 14 years ago
Vadim Pisarevsky 68378ac7e4 fixed crash in color-lab (ticket #627) 14 years ago
Vadim Pisarevsky 099388bd12 fixed crashes in color-luv & color-lab when gcc 4.2 on x64 is used (tickets #502, #627) 14 years ago
Vadim Pisarevsky ebb9c61546 fixed bug with Mat::dataend initialization. Now morph-ex test passes; Also fixed CV_Assert() implementation 14 years ago
Vadim Pisarevsky 4a14795eb6 fixed several gcc 4.1 warnings 14 years ago
Vadim Pisarevsky 89f64681d0 fixed several warnings; modified size comparison: m1.size() == m2.size() => m1.size == m2.size 14 years ago